Features that Enhance the Bible Reading Experience
Bible apps are not just digital versions of the book. They offer several features that improve the reading experience.
Many apps include audio, so users can listen to scripture as they go about their day. This is particularly helpful for those who have difficulty reading or prefer auditory learning.
Another useful feature is the ability to highlight verses and take notes. Users can personalize their reading experience by marking passages that resonate with them.
For example, the YouVersion Bible App offers daily Bible verse notifications, encouraging users to reflect on scripture regularly. Another feature that many Bible apps offer is verse-by-verse commentary.
This feature provides users with deeper insights into the text, making Bible reading a more educational experience. These features help people stay engaged and immersed in the word of God.
Social and Community Engagement
One of the key aspects of Bible apps is their ability to foster community. Through apps, users can share verses with friends or join online study groups.
This communal aspect of Bible reading helps believers stay accountable and deepen their faith together. Many apps allow users to interact with others via discussion boards or social media integration.
For instance, the Bible App for Kids provides interactive storytelling elements that engage children in Bible narratives. Parents can join in by reading together and discussing the stories with their children.
This sense of community enriches the reading experience, turning Bible study into a shared journey.
Additionally, apps like Bible.is allow users to share their progress and reflections with others, creating a global community of believers. As a result, Bible apps are transforming individual reading experiences into collective spiritual growth.

Accessibility and Inclusivity
Bible apps make the scriptures more accessible than ever. Not only are translations available in various languages, but many apps now cater to specific accessibility needs.
Features such as text-to-speech, screen reader compatibility, and customizable font sizes help users with visual impairments. These inclusivity features ensure that more people can engage with the Bible, regardless of their abilities.
Moreover, apps make it easier for people in non-Christian regions to explore the scriptures. Translating the
Bible into thousands of languages has made the word of God accessible to remote areas, providing hope to individuals who otherwise may not have had the opportunity to read the Bible in their native tongue.
By increasing accessibility, Bible apps are helping spread the message of Christianity across borders and languages.

Challenges and Considerations
Despite their many advantages, Bible apps come with their challenges. One major concern is the potential for distractions. While reading the Bible on a mobile device is convenient, users are often tempted by notifications or social media apps.
To address this, many Bible apps include a “Do Not Disturb” feature to limit distractions while reading.
Another challenge is the issue of authenticity. Some critics argue that digital versions of the Bible may not always accurately reflect the original texts or translations.
However, many reputable Bible apps use carefully curated translations from trusted sources, ensuring the text’s integrity remains intact. App developers must maintain transparency and reliability to preserve the sacredness of scripture.
